BLUEBERRY SMOOTHIE


This is the best smoothie I've made so far (if I do say so myself). Yes possibly even outranking my beloved peanut butter and chocolate smoothie (recipe for this will be hitting the blog in the near future!). What's not to love about blueberries, they're a superfood containing vitamin K, C and fibre to name a few. They're also full of antioxidents, I like to think of them as natures pearls, nutritious sweets if you will.

Ingredients (makes 2 small servings or one large):

- 3 frozen bananas
- 1 pack of frozen blueberries
- 2 tbsp flaxseed
- 1 tbsp chia seeds
- 1 tbsp agave syrup
- 1 cup almond milk 
- Dash of water
- Small handful of frozen blueberries to add on top
- Sprinkling of chia seeds 

Instructions:

1.) Add all the ingredients to a blender and set on high. If your blender won't handle frozen fruits try using fresh fruit and adding ice for a similar effect.
2.) Decorate with more frozen blueberries and chia seeds on on top
